Statement from South Northamptonshire Council on the decision by the Secretary of State to approve proposals for a rail freight terminal off the A508 near Roade.
Published: Friday, 11th October 2019
Cllr Phil Bignell, South Northamptonshire Council’s deputy leader and portfolio holder for planning, said: “There are two similar proposals for this area, and while we would rather have had neither, Northampton Gateway had the least impact on the district and delivered the most benefits.
“Roade is in desperate need of a bypass and junction 15 of the M1 requires improvements if it is to keep up with the pace of change.
“We will work closely with developers to minimise disruption to residents and maximise the benefits this development might bring to the wider district.
“The Rail Central proposals continue to falter after the applicant’s failure to prepare proper evidence and to stick to their own timetable.
“We would hope the Planning Inspectorate will now see the people of South Northants are doing their bit for the national good and that further development in this area is unwarranted.”
